Classic Equine Equipment, located among the rolling hills and horse farms of Southern Missouri, was founded in 1991 on a love for horses and a commitment to their ultimate care and safety. Though a lot has changed since then, our mission remains the same:
To provide quality stall systems, barn components, and accessories to meet the needs of all horse owners.

About Classic Equine Equipment

Located in Fredericktown, Missouri, Classic Equine Equipment has been the first choice for horse stalls and stabling equipment for the past 30 years. We offer the widest product lines in the industry while continuing to expand through innovation and strategic alliances. Classic Equine Equipment is a wholly owned subsidiary of Morton Buildings, Inc.
